Everest
Everest Double Glazing, one of the largest UK window manufacturers, offers high-quality windows for a competitive price. The windows are constructed from uPVC aluminum, uPVC, and timber, and are available in a variety of styles, colors, and designs. They also offer a variety of custom options to fit the style of your home. Additionally, Everest offers a number of financing options to help you pay for your new double glazing.
Everest's history goes back to the 1960s when it began producing aluminium secondary glazing in Waltham Abbey, Essex. The company was acquired by the private equity firm Better Capital in 2012, and it now employs more than 2,000 people across the nation. Its uPVC frames and aluminium frames are extremely energy efficient, allowing you to cut down on your energy bills. Windows have internal beading to prevent them from being taken away. The locks are supported by Secured by Design - a police program to increase the security of your home.
The Everest collection includes casement windows, sash windows and tilt-and turn windows. They are available in a range of colours that include grey and wood grain uPVC. The company also has a variety of doors designed to match any style of home, ranging from bi-folding doors and sliding doors to traditional styles. The company also offers a variety of aesthetic glass options like acid-etched or textured.

Safestyle UK
This company offers a wide variety of replacement double-glazing windows. Customers can pick from casement, French, tilt-and-turn, and bay windows. They also offer a variety of finishes, colors, and glazing options. The company also provides online quoting tools, visualisers, and financing options. The company also offers the guarantee of the lowest cost and recycles 95% its waste.
Safestyle UK specialises in energy-efficient doors and windows, and it is renowned for its high-quality products and exceptional customer service. Its uPVC product line includes cream, white and black, as well as various styles and colors. They also come with a variety of finishes, including a woodgrain effect and come with or without decorative glass. The Legacy and Eco Diamond sash windows have earned an A-grade for energy efficiency.
The company is a major double glazing firm serving customers in England, Scotland and Wales. It employs a self-employed network of surveyors, engineers, and fitters. Customers can count on a fast, reliable service and the highest quality of workmanship. The company's reputation for excellence has helped it to achieve a Trustpilot score of 4.3 with over 11,192 customer reviews.
Safestyle offers custom-made products in addition to its standard range for homeowners who require something more specific. These custom-made products are created to order at their Yorkshire factory and then delivered to the home of the homeowner to be installed. Every week, they make 6,000 frames and 15 000 repair misted double glazing near me-glazed sealed units. This keeps more than 600 employees employed.
